Tohāna,
Tohāna is a town located in the Indian state of Haryana. It is known for its historical significance, with several ancient temples and monuments scattered throughout the area. The town has a predominantly agrarian economy, with farming being the primary source of livelihood for the local residents.
Tohāna also boasts a vibrant cultural scene, with traditional music and dance performances often held during festivals and celebrations.

Tohāna Famous Food
Must-Try local dishes
Bajra Khichdi
A wholesome dish made with pearl millet and lentils, flavored with local spices. Best enjoyed at local eateries and dhabas.
Must-Try!
Kadhi Pakora
A yogurt-based curry with deep-fried gram flour fritters, offering a comforting and tangy flavor. Widely available at home kitchens and small-scale restaurants.
Sarson da Saag and Makki di Roti
A classic Punjabi dish featuring mustard greens with cornmeal flatbread, offering a delightful combination of textures and flavors. Best savored at traditional Punjabi dhabas.
